使用 Styled Components 创建图表并构建一个基于 TypeScript(TS)和尽可能轻量依赖的 React 库(避免使用 D3 和其他类似的库)是一项非常有趣的挑战。我们可以这样做: 首先,通过在项目中安装和配置 Styled Components 和 TypeScript,可以开始构建图表组件。通过创建一个通用的图表容器组件,可以添加柱状图、折线图等默认图表组件。 接下来,我们将这些默认图表组件导入到工具栏、路径和琶音等组件中,并根据需要进行修改和调整。通过 Styled Components 的强大功能,我们可以轻松地定制这些组件的样式和交互方式。 最后,将所有修改后的图表组件整合到一个 React 库中,并通过合理的路径结构和组件树进行组织。这样,当需要使用这些图表时,只需将它们导入到项目中并使用即可。最终,这些努力将带来更好的用户体验和更高的利润。

网站地址:https://styled-chart.com